Figure 3: Calibrated 86 GHz light curves of 0716+714, 0836+710 and 1928+738 during 2003 November 10 to 16. The dashed line on the top inset represents the best linear fit to the 0716+714 flux density evolution during 2003 November 10 to 15. |
